Ongole: The Prakasam District Kamma Seva Sangham distributed cheques worth Rs 8 lakh to 20 engineering students and 43 laptops worth Rs 27 lakh to 43 students at a programme held here on Sunday.

Speaking at the programme, AP Technology Services Chairman Mannava Mohana Krishna observed that no donation is greater than the gift of education. He said that the welfare programmes of the Prakasam District Kamma Seva Sangham had inspired him deeply and assured full financial support to the organisation. He praised the 1K Donors Club concept as a worthy initiative. Sangham president Mandava Murali Krishna urged the students who receive help to grow in life and support such programmes in the future.

Sangham founder chairman Dr Kamepalli Sitaramaiah, TDP NRI Wing Australia president Enikapati Venkatesh, Nuziveedu Seeds Group general manager Chintamaneni Yesudasu and other leaders attended the programme.
